Basement Drainage Installation in Dothan, AL
Basement drainage installation services focus on managing excess water around a property's foundation to prevent leaks, flooding, and water damage. This process typically involves installing drainage systems such as sump pumps, interior or exterior drain tiles, and waterproof barriers to direct water away from the basement. These projects are often requested by homeowners experiencing recurring moisture issues, basement flooding, or concerns about potential foundation damage, especially in areas prone to heavy rainfall or poor drainage.
Property owners interested in basement drainage installation usually want to understand the different system options available, the scope of work involved, and how the installation can protect their home over time. It’s important to consider factors like the existing foundation type, soil conditions, and the property's drainage needs before requesting services. Proper planning and installation can help ensure effective water management, reducing the risk of future water intrusion and maintaining the integrity of the basement space.

Common Basement Drainage Installation Jobs
Basement Drainage Systems - installation of effective drainage solutions to prevent water buildup.
Interior Drainage Channels - placement of channels inside the basement to direct water away from foundation walls.
French Drains - installation of underground pipes surrounded by gravel to manage groundwater flow.
Sump Pump Systems - setup of sump pumps to remove accumulated water and reduce flooding risk.
Waterproofing Solutions - sealing and barrier methods to keep basements dry and protect against moisture intrusion.
Drainage Repair Services - fixing or upgrading existing drainage systems to improve performance and prevent leaks.
Basement Drainage Installation Questions
What is basement drainage installation? It involves setting up systems to direct water away from a basement to prevent flooding and water damage.
Why is proper drainage important for basements? Effective drainage helps keep basements dry, reduces mold growth, and protects the foundation from water-related issues.
What types of drainage systems are commonly installed? Common options include interior drain tiles, exterior waterproofing, and sump pump systems to manage water flow.
How can I tell if my basement needs drainage improvements? Signs include damp walls, musty odors, or water pooling during heavy rains, indicating drainage issues that may need attention.
